Your label Fonk, tell us more.

Fonk was my platform I launched to help producers that were up and coming in the industry but that were finding it hard to break through. I wanted to use my position in the industry to give back and help those artists out – we’ve grown to a strong collective now with a whole lot of genres including groovier house sounds and the more bombastic big-room stuff. I’m excited for us to grow and grow and for the fans to hear what is next.

You’re track STAY feat. INNA, Romania’s best export (an artist with more than 2 billion YouTube views). Tell us more.

I was a fan of INNA and her voice and when I was playing a Romanian festival I was asked if I knew any local artists, I said, “Of Course, INNA!”. Not long after, I’m guessing her management saw this and we connected … and got to work on a track together. I was really pleased with the results of ‘Stay’, I think she really elevated the track with her vocals to have this unique, summer vibe.

Tell us more about your collaboration with luxury Dutch brand Van Gils.

Ah! It was great working with a prestigious Dutch brand like those guys. They make the most amazing, smart suits and I designed my own range of “sneaker suits” with them, so cool cuts, neat and comfortable fabrics but still super sleek!
